Job DescriptionTITLE: Secretary: Summer School Program (6 months contract)
SCALE: DETERMINED BY BOARD
UPON RECOMMENDATION OF THE SUPERINTENDENT
SALARY: PRC NATIONAL SALARY SCHEDULE
POSITION SUMMARY:
The Secretary will assist the Summer Program Director in all aspects of setting up and coordinating the Summer School Program.
SUPERVISED, EVALUATED BY & REPORTS TO:
Summer Program Director
QUALIFICATIONS:
? Excellent communication skills, ability to work cooperatively with the Students, administrators, and faculty.
? Ability to represent SAS in a professional manner.
? Be self-motivated and able to organize and prioritize work with minimal direction
? Comfortable in situations where constant changes frequently occur.
? Experience in a school or office setting coordination activities, budgets, orders, purchase, student registration, telephone answering and email inquiries.
? Knowledge and use of advanced application pertaining to word processing and spreadsheets.
? Ability to speak and write fluently in both English and Chinese is preferred.
PARTIAL LISTING OF D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
? Performs secretarial and clerical duties as required.
- Works effectively with teachers, parents and students.
- Creates a rapport with all members of the SAS community.
- Dresses appropriately for meeting the public.
? Types and duplicates letters, bulletins, forms and reports.
? Assists in the co-ordination of the Summer School Program.
? Assists in processing student applications.
? Assists in processing and tracking tuition and fee payments
? Assists in managing the Summer Program budget
? Assists in preparing the housing for all incoming summer school teachers.
? Assists in allocation of survival kits for all summer school teachers.
? Assists in organizing the transportation schedule.
? Assists in allocating classroom supplies.
? Monitors student attendance.
? Translate documents when required.
? Assistants with program website information.
? Responsible for ordering office and classroom supplies.
? Performs other duties as assigned.
